### v4.2.0 — Changed defaults

Encoding detection for uploaded text files in the Fernwick ingest service now defaults to strict mode. Previously, ambiguous byte sequences fell back to Latin-1, which silently corrupted several Hollybrook customer imports. Strict mode rejects files it cannot classify with high confidence and returns a descriptive error. If you need to reproduce pre-4.2 behavior during testing, compare against the new default configuration shown here.

service settings:
PRAWYN_PIN=9848
PRAWYN_METRICS_HOST=metrics.prawyn.lumicworks.corp
PRAWYN_LOG_LEVEL=warn
PRAWYN_TENANT=pelius

The StringHarvest script extracts translation strings from the Morvale app repositories and pushes them to the localization queue. Under normal operation it runs unattended on a nightly schedule and requires no credentials beyond its service token.

If the token is revoked or the nightly run fails during a release freeze, break-glass access is permitted. This grants temporary write access to the localization queue and is fully audited. Record your name and reason in the access log, then authenticate with the passphrase below.

unlock words, fajof-kahip: ulaath-zorael-drumir

Subject: Handover — Tidysweep Branch Bot. Hi team, as I rotate off release duty, please note that Tidysweep runs nightly to archive branches inactive for ninety days; support should pause it during freeze windows via the Larchmont dashboard. The bot authenticates to our repository host when pushing archive tags, and it does so with the deploy key below.

rollout seal: bky4_yke3

# Break-Glass: Catalog Cache Invalidation

Scope: the Pinrow product catalog at Veldstone Retail. If stale prices persist after a purge and the Hollowmere invalidation queue is wedged, use break-glass to flush the edge tier directly. Contractors: get verbal sign-off from the catalog lead first. Steps: open the Hollowmere admin shell, select emergency-flush, confirm the tenant, and run it once — repeated flushes thrash the origin. Access is logged and expires after 20 minutes. Unseal the admin shell with the passphrase below.

recovery phrase for kahop-tajog: istix-casvan